Поддерживаемые члены Qt 3 класса QObjectОписанные ниже члены класса являются частью слоя поддержки Qt 3. Они введены для поддержки старого кода в Qt 4. Мы советуем не использовать их во вновь создаваемом коде. Открытые функции
Защищенные функции
Статические защищенные члены
Описание функций-членовQObject::QObject ( QObject * parent, const char * name )Эта функция перегружает QObject(). Создаёт новый объект QObject с заданными parent и именем объекта name. bool QObject::checkConnectArgs ( const char * signal, const QObject * object, const char * method ) [protected]Вместо этого используйте QMetaObject::checkConnectArgs(). QObject * QObject::child ( const char * objName, const char * inheritsClass = 0, bool recursiveSearch = true ) constИщет среди потомков и необязательно внуках этого объекта, а также возвращает потомка с именем objName, который наследует inheritsClass. Если inheritsClass равно 0 (по умолчанию), соответствует любой класс. Если recursiveSearch равно true (по умолчанию), child() выполнит поиск в глубину потомков объекта. Если таких объектов нет эта функция возвратит 0. Если их более одного, то возвращается первый найденный. const char * QObject::className () constВместо этого используйте metaObject()->className(). void QObject::insertChild ( QObject * object )Вместо этого используйте setParent(), т.е., вызывайте object->setParent(this). bool QObject::isA ( const char * className ) constСравнивайте вместо этого className с metaObject()->className() объекта. const char * QObject::name () constВместо этого используйте objectName(). Смотрите также setName(). const char * QObject::name ( const char * defaultName ) constВместо этого используйте objectName(). QByteArray QObject::normalizeSignalSlot ( const char * signalSlot ) [static protected]Вместо этого используйте QMetaObject::normalizedSignature(). void QObject::removeChild ( QObject * object )Вместо этого используйте setParent(), т.е., вызывайте object->setParent(0). void QObject::setName ( const char * name )Вместо этого используйте setObjectName(). Смотрите также name(). |
Попытка перевода Qt документации. Если есть желание присоединиться, или если есть замечания или пожелания, то заходите на форум: Перевод Qt документации на русский язык... Люди внесшие вклад в перевод: Команда переводчиков |